Output 6b78913d840c962669bf0323bd5adf430fc9e8a31cb5375a37a2faed65fe8b63:4

value
611381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 394a762527bbe36daf192477ef007d4ba71fecd6 OP_EQUAL
address
36uwe9thkcnp83VEB7nuQut4hnLEgyFj3a
transaction
6b78913d840c962669bf0323bd5adf430fc9e8a31cb5375a37a2faed65fe8b63
spent
true